Wearable EEG Devices Market Size, Growth and Future Trends by 2031

The EEG Devices Market is witnessing consistent growth due to the increasing need for advanced neurological monitoring solutions. The EEG Devices are widely used to monitor brain activity and are essential in diagnosing conditions such as epilepsy, brain tumors, sleep disorders, and head injuries. As healthcare systems continue to evolve, the demand for efficient, non-invasive diagnostic tools is rising, positioning EEG devices as a key component of modern medical infrastructure. The growing focus on neurological health and early disease detection is further strengthening the adoption of EEG devices across hospitals, diagnostic centers, and research institutions. With continuous advancements in medical technology, EEG systems are becoming more accurate, portable, and user-friendly. The EEG Devices Market Drivers are playing a crucial role in shaping the future of neurological diagnostics and monitoring technologies. The market is projected to grow significantly, reaching USD 2.0 billion by 2031 from USD 1.13 billion in 2023, registering a CAGR of 7.3 percent during the forecast period. This steady expansion highlights the increasing importance of electroencephalography devices in diagnosing neurological conditions and supporting advanced research applications.

Market Segmentation Insights:

The EEG devices market is segmented based on product, application, device type, and end user. By product, the market includes 8-channel EEG, 21-channel EEG, 25-channel EEG, 32-channel EEG, 40-channel EEG, and multi-channel EEG systems. Among these, multi-channel and higher-channel devices are gaining traction due to their ability to provide detailed and accurate brain activity data.

In terms of application, EEG devices are widely used for sleep disorders, neuroscience, head trauma, brain tumors, and other neurological conditions. The growing incidence of these conditions is driving the demand for EEG-based diagnostics. Based on device type, the market is divided into standalone devices and portable devices. Portable EEG systems are witnessing increased adoption due to their flexibility and ease of use. By end user, hospitals and clinics hold a significant share of the market, followed by diagnostic centers, academic and research institutes, and research centers.
